Job Summary:
The Hartford School District is seeking a special education teacher to join our dedicated and passionate special education team. This special educator will be providing instruction and emotional supports within a therapeutic classroom. Candidates should have a strong background in providing high quality intervention services, trauma informed practices, and supporting and collaborating with colleagues It is important to have a solid understanding of how to partner with teachers around supporting students with emotional disturbances or students with trauma within a mainstream classroom.
The ideal candidate will have strong classroom management skills, be able to collect data to build and implement behavior support plans, and excellent communication skills. Implementing research-based structured math and reading interventions, such as Orton Gillingham, and using diagnostic tools to inform instruction is also required. This special educator will be part of a team working within the therapeutic classroom, and under supervision of the building Principal, HSD's Clinical Director, and the Director of Special Education.
At the Hartford School District we believe that all students can learn and our special educators are essential partners in this work. We are looking for strong communication skills, problem-solving oriented staff, and educators who believe that relationships come first.
HSD is committed to a proactive, inclusive and trauma-informed approach that contributes to and promotes a safe, healthy, socially and academically vibrant climate for all stakeholders where building positive relationships is the priority.
